APC Dist.
WA, NT, SA (native and naturalised), Qld (native and doubtfully naturalised), NSW (native and naturalised), ACT, Vic, Tas
Plantae / Charophyta / Equisetopsida / Magnoliidae / Asteranae / Apiales / Apiaceae
